Skye, Ross, Inverness, Argyle, and Perth Shires, 14 days.
1st day. Glasgow to Oban by Crinan Canal, leaving on a Monday
or Wednesday, so as to catch the Skye steamer the next
morning at Oban, page 434.
2d day. Oban to Broadford in Skye (steamer) on Tuesday or Friday
mornings, page 482.
3d day. Broadford to Shgachan by private conveyance, boat, and
ponies, passing the Spar Cave, Loch Scavaig, Coruisk,
the Cucnullin Mountains, and Glen Sligachan, page 487.
4th day. Sligachan to Portree by mail or private conveyance,
visiting the Storr Rock same day, page 494.
5th day. Portree to Oban by steamer ; or Portree to Jeantown in
Ross-shire by mail, page 503.
6th day. Jeantown to Dingwall by mail, thence per private convey¬
ance to Inverness, page 540.
7th day. Inverness to Bannavie by Caledonian Canal, page 510.
8th day. Climb Ben Nevis, page 514.
9th day. Bannavie to Oban, continuing to Staffa, Iona, or Glencoe,
as the steamer may suit, changing steamer at Oban,
page 457.
10th day. Oban to Iona or Glencoe—which ever was unvisited on
previous day (steamer), page 476.
11th day. Oban to Glasgow by Crinan Canal (steamer); or Oban to
Inverary by Loch Awe (coach), page 447.
12th day. Inverary to Tarbet, Loch Lomond (coach), page 445.
13th day. Tarbet to the Trosachs by Loch Katrine (steamer and
coach), page 224.
14th day. Trosachs to Edinburgh or Glasgow (coach and railway),
page 224.
